Meldreth Train Station, managed by Great Northern, offers a variety of facilities to ensure a hassle-free journey. The ticket office is open Monday through Saturday until early afternoon, though there are ticket machines available around the clock for your convenience. Plus, if you've purchased your ticket online, you can easily collect it at the station.
While there aren’t any waiting rooms, Meldreth does provide seating areas for commuters. CCTV cameras are strategically placed to maintain security throughout the station, including the 45-space car park operated by APCOA Parking UK. Parking here is free, adding additional convenience compared to many larger UK stations.
The station may have limitations when it comes to full accessibility. While there is step-free access to Platform 2, accessing Platform 1 to London requires navigating steps. Therefore, travelers needing assistance can find additional support through staff assistance and a mobile assistance team available during station hours. Unfortunately, there are no accessible toilets available.
For cyclists, there are 20 bicycle storage spaces available by the station entrance to Platform 2. However, be aware that there is no cycle hire facility or shelters for bicycles. Stoneleigh station is equipped to cater to the essential needs of travelers. The ticket office is open during the morning hours, 06:10 to 13:00 during weekdays and 08:00 to 14:00 on weekends, ensuring accessibility for early and mid-morning commuters. Alternatively, ticket machines are available for independent purchases, including options for collecting tickets bought online. This ensures seamless, hassle-free travel arrangements for visitors.
Though data reveals no on-site refreshment facilities, shopping, or ATM services, Stoneleigh station ensures passengers’ safety with CCTV surveillance and customer help points. While there are no staff available for direct assistance, automated systems and helplines aim to mitigate this limitation.
Stoneleigh station offers some support for disabled travelers through accessible ticket machines supporting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, it is essential to note that there is no step-free access, which might present challenges for those with mobility issues. Passengers requiring additional support when boarding trains can receive assistance from train guards, an invaluable service facilitated by South Western Railway.
For those looking to extend their travels beyond the station, Stoneleigh offers several transport options. Rail replacement services connect travelers to Wimbledon or Epsom, indicative of efficient transit in case of disruptions. Despite the absence of direct cycle hire options, cycling remains a plausible option with available racks and CCTV for bicycle storage.
